      <description>TREES, JAMES THOMAS Sept. 9, 1950 to April 1, 2003 James, 52, of Greenfield, Ind. died April 1, 2003. Born in Dearborn Mich. He was employed as a lead HVAC Installer for 15 years at Koehring and Sons, Indianapolis and past member of Knights of Columbus. He is preceded in death by his father James C. Trees and brother John Trees. He is survived by his wife, Patricia Driscoll Trees; daughters, Melissa Marie Trees, Emily Michelle Trees, Valerie Gilliatte, Tara Gilliatte, Katie Gilliatte, and Amy Harwell, all of Indiana; brothers, David Trees of Walcott, Iowa, Joseph Trees of Sterling Heights, Mich., and Robert Trees of San Diego, Calif.; sisters, Carol Mateer of Fairland, Ind., Janet Fislar of Indianapolis, Ind., Joyce Saladino of Naples, Fla., and Lee Ann Molnar of Imlay City, Mich. Visitation: Pasco Memorial Mortuary, Fri., April 4, 2003 from 4p.m. to 8p.m. Services Sat., April 5, 2003, 10a.m. Holy Spirit Catholic Church. Burial Park Cemetery, Greenfield Ind. Memorials to Hancock c/o Hospice and Brain Tumor Assoc. Published in the San Diego Union-Tribune on 4/3/2003. (volunteer submission)</description>
